| Name | α-HNJNAc |
|---|
| Description | α-HNJNAc is a potent, competitive hexosaminidases inhibitor without interfering with other glycosidases[1]. |
|---|---|
| Related Catalog | |
| In Vitro | α-HNJNAc (10, 100µM) shows no effect on GM00737 and GM01426 cell lines, but some effect on GM02931 cell line with a significant 1.8 fold activity increase. a-HNJNAc (100µM; 3 days) has no toxicity on human HL60 cell proliferation[1]. NAGLU is inhibited more efficiently by a-HNJNAc (67 µM) than by the uncorrectly configured b-HNJNAc (374 µM)[1]. |
